1.手机上导入Charles根证书 按照如下图所示操作即可: 2.设置Android 手机代理 按照如下图的配置设置是最简单的: 3.添加SSL代理设置 配置到此,我们就可以正常抓取到Https明文数据了。 (Android 6.0及以下版本的部分手机因为厂商高度订制,可能存在安装CA证书失败的情况,这会导致无法通过Charles抓取到https的数据) 三、...
下面是systrace的抓取方法: 1.安装systrace工具 在Linux或macOS系统中,可以使用以下命令来安装systrace工具: ``` pip install systrace ``` 在Windows系统中,可以使用以下命令来安装systrace工具: ``` python -m pip install systrace ``` 2.连接手机 将手机通过USB连接到计算机上,并确保开启开发者选项和USB调试...
在Android Studio中,可以通过以下步骤抓取Systrace: 打开Android Studio,并连接你的Android设备。 打开你想要分析的应用或进程。 打开Android Profiler窗口(可以通过点击工具栏上的“Profile”按钮打开)。 在CPU Profiler中,点击左下角的“Record CPU activity”按钮开始抓取Systrace。 复现你想要分析的性能问题。 点击“Sto...
为了使用Systrace工具,开发人员需要掌握一些抓取方法。 一、安装ADB工具 在使用Systrace工具之前,需要确保ADB工具已经安装在你的电脑上。ADB工具可以帮助你与设备进行通信并控制其行为。如果你还没有安装ADB工具,可以通过官方网站下载并安装。 二、启动Systrace工具 在终端中输入以下命令: $ cd android-sdk/platform-tools...
在操作抓取systrace之前,不妨先参考[Android systrace系列] systrace的信息从哪里来,来熟悉systrace log类别的掩码,和ftrace事件的路径。 下面来说明抓取开机systrace的步骤,这里需要编译手机的userdebug版本 1. 全局搜所有rc文件,将所有关闭trace的命令注释,例如这一句 #write /sys/kernel/debug/tracing/instances/wifi/tr...
systrace抓取log命令 1 -t 后面的10是抓10秒的 trace日志 -b 40960 是buffer缓冲区大小 参考链接:https://blog.csdn.net/gqg_guan/article/details/130429263
51CTO博客已为您找到关于systrace抓取 android的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及systrace抓取 android问答内容。更多systrace抓取 android相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
1.systrace.py 文件目录如下:2.systrace.py 转换命令如下:3.systrace.py 源文件如下:System Traceing的主要有以下功能 点击开始后手机会有通知提示,然后我们复现问题,问题复现结束后,关闭trace 即可。此功能可以抓取 app 运行缓慢以及丢帧等问题的trace log。我们可以根据不同的情况,配置抓取不同的...
1.手机端抓取Systrace 的方法 System Traceing 打开方法一 进入Settings>>System>>Developer options>>System Traceing点击即可。 System Traceing 打开方法一 System Traceing 打开方法二 在Settings界面直接搜索System Traceing也可以。 System Traceing 打开方法二 ...
51CTO博客已为您找到关于android systrace抓取的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及android systrace抓取问答内容。更多android systrace抓取相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。